There is some mystery about Cortina pipes. Cortina's were apparently made by Bari in Denmark in the 1960's. These examples tend to have horn ferrules and small stamping ringing the shank. However Pipephil lists Cortina Pipes associated with both Georg Jensen, and Stern ? [1]

The models with the sandblast and smooth bands, and horn ferrules with aluminum inner reinforcements are made by Georg Jensen, as I have seen exact same design and build on a Georg Jensen.
